How to install Dart and run Dart Programs offline on Android?

Run Dart Programs On Android

Dart is a object-oriented, open source and general purpose Programming Language developed by Google. It is used to build applications for multiple platforms like Mobile, Desktop, Server and Web Application. The main purpose of Dart Programming Language is to create awesome User Interface for Mobile, Desktop and Web Applications using Flutter Framework.

In this tutorial, we will focus on how you can Install and Run Dart programs on your Android Device. You will be able to run your Dart programs offline in your Android after following the below steps.


Installing Dart on your Android Device.

  1. In order to run Dart programs on your Android, you need an app called Termux. Install the app from the Play Store.
    Termux App on Play Store
  2. After installation is complete, open the app and wait till the app configuration is complete.
    You need to turn on the internet to download necessary files for Termux during the first launch after app installation or clearing its data.
  3. After the app's initial configuration is complete, you will see this window.
    Termux App Home
  4. To run Dart programs, you should install Dart package on Termux. Type the following commands in the terminal to install Dart on Termux.
    $ pkg install dart
  5. It may take about a minute for installation depending on your internet speed. After installation completes successfully, you can run Dart programs on your Android.

Installing Dart Code Editor in Termux.

To write Dart program, you need to install an Editor. In this tutorial, we will use Micro text editor. It is a good text editor for Termux which has many cool features. It also supports the shortcut keys that are used in PC like CTRL + V to Paste the Copied Text, CTRL + S to Save File, CTRL + Q to Exit/Quit the Editor, etc.

  1. To install Micro Editor on Termux, use the following command.
    $ pkg install micro
  2. Once you successfully install the Micro Editor, type the following command to create a new Dart Program.
    $ micro main.dartHere, main.dart is the name of the Dart Program. You can use any name for your code in place of main.
  3. After you run the command, you can see an editor where you can write your Dart programs.
    Micro Text Editor on Termux
  4. Write the Dart program on the Editor and press CTRL + S to Save your program.
    Dart Code In Micro Editor

Executing the Dart Programs.

Once you write the Dart program, you need to run it to see its output.
To run your Dart code, follow these steps.

  1. Run the following command on the terminal.
    $ dart main.dartHere, main.dart is the name of the Dart program you have created.
  2. Once after running the command, you can see its output on the terminal.
    Output Of the Dart Program

Writing Dart Programs on External code editor.

Instead of using the Termux Editors, you can also write Dart programs on any one of your favorite Code Editor app and execute them. I am using Acode code editor in this tutorial which is my favorite code editor with many cool features.

To write your Dart programs on code editor, follow these steps:

  1. Download and install any one of your favourite code editor app and create a new file.
  2. Write your Dart program on the editor as in the image below.
    Writing Dart Program on Code Editor
  3. Save the file as <filename>.dart.
    You can use your desired name for your Dart program in place of <filename>.
    You should save your file in the root of your sdcard or where you can easily get its location because you need to provide the file location to run your code.
  4. You are now ready to run your Dart Program.

Executing Dart programs from external file.

After writing your program, you can run it to see the output. To run your Dart code, follow these steps:

  1. First of all, you need to provide permission to read and write files from your Internal or External Storage if your Android is Android 6.0(Marshmallow) or later. To provide storage permission to Termux, run the following command in the terminal and click Allow to allow the permission.
    $ termux-setup-storage
  2. To run the program, you need to get the path of your program file. You can use your file manager and see the details/ properties of the file to see the path.
  3. Once you have the file path, open Termux app.
  4. Type the following command to run your code.
    $ dart /path/filename.dart
  5. If your program exist on the given path, it will show output accordingly as shown in the given image.
    Executing Dart Program From External File

Conclusion

Following this tutorial, you have successfully installed Dart on your Android, and now you can run your Dart programs offline on your Android Device.
